Subversion Repositories HelenOS-historic

Compare Revisions

Ignore whitespace Rev 396 → Rev 406

/SPARTAN/trunk/arch/ia32/_link.ld.in
25,8 → 25,6
unmapped_kdata_start = .;
*(K_DATA_START);
unmapped_kdata_end = .;
LONG(0xdeadbeaf); /* TODO: remove 0xdeadbeaf */
}
.mapped (PA2KA(BOOT_OFFSET+BOOTSTRAP_OFFSET)+SIZEOF(.unmapped)): AT (BOOTSTRAP_OFFSET+SIZEOF(.unmapped)) {
/SPARTAN/trunk/arch/ia32/src/smp/ap.S
30,7 → 30,7
# Init code for application processors.
#
 
.section K_TEXT_START_2
.section K_TEXT_START_2, "ax"
 
#ifdef __SMP__
 
/SPARTAN/trunk/arch/ia32/src/boot/boot.S
33,7 → 33,7
#include <arch/mm/page.h>
#include <arch/pm.h>
 
.section K_TEXT_START
.section K_TEXT_START, "ax"
.global kernel_image_start
 
KTEXT=8
243,7 → 243,7
ret
 
 
.section K_DATA_START
.section K_DATA_START, "aw", @progbits
 
.align 4096
page_directory:
/SPARTAN/trunk/arch/ia32/src/boot/memmap.S
35,7 → 35,7
.global e801memorysize
 
.code16
.section K_TEXT_START_2
.section K_TEXT_START_2, "ax"
 
memmap_arch_init:
e820begin:
108,7 → 108,7
ret
 
 
.section K_DATA_START
.section K_DATA_START, "aw", @progbits
 
#memory size in 1 kb chunks
e801memorysize: